Dominating the YouTube Algorithm: A Guide for Aspiring Creators
Launching your journey as a YouTube creator is an exhilarating adventure. But navigating the ever-evolving YouTube algorithm can feel similar to deciphering ancient riddles. Don't worry, though! With a little savvy, you can decipher its secrets and boost your channel's visibility. The key is to understand what the algorithm truly values: engaging content that here keeps viewers.
- Develop captivating video intros that evoke curiosity.
- Fine-tune your video descriptions with relevant keywords.
- Connect with your viewers by responding their comments and building a community.
By consistently creating high-quality content and communicating with your audience, you'll transmit to the algorithm that your channel is valuable and worthy.

Crafting a Thriving YouTube Community in the Modern Era
Navigating the dynamic world of YouTube requires more than just creating captivating content. To truly flourish, creators must build a loyal and engaged community around their channel. This implies passionately connecting with viewers, promoting a sense of belonging, and offering valuable knowledge. By implementing strategic approaches, creators can develop their channels into thriving hubs that impact audiences on a deeper level.
- Employ the power of community features like live streams, polls, and Q&A sessions to boost viewer participation.
- Interact to comments thoughtfully and promptly to highlight your passion to building relationships.
- Partner with other creators in your genre to reach your audience and interlink content.
